The two mechanisms by which antisense RNA can act to stop translation is by;
-Binding of antisense to mRNA physically blocks ribosome binding and translation.
- Also Via triggering RNase H that degrades the mRNA of a DNA-mRNA heteroduplex.
Explanation;
Antisense RNA is a type of non-coding RNA that binds to complementary mRNA sequences and induces gene repression by inhibiting translation or degrading messenger RNA.
